> > > > For Exchange2000, in Exchange System Manager the 'mailbox' will not
> > > > show up until either the user logs into their 'mailbox' or
> > > an object
> > > > is sent to the mailbox, like a new email.

> > > > I have setup an A/A Exchange cluster with SP3 in parallel with an
> > > > Exchange
> > > > 5.5 SP4. I can move mailboxes from Exch5.5 to any of the
> > > other servers
> > > > or vice versa. But When I create a new user with a mailbox, the
> > > > mailbox is not created on any of the cluster servers. But when one
> > > > looks at the property of the account under the exchange
> > > general tab it
> > > > shows that the mailbox store is on one of the cluster servers.
> > > > Does anyone have any idea why is this happening.
> > > > I can of course create a mailbox on the Ex 5.5 server and
> > > the account
> > > > does show up on the AD and mailbox is created fine!
